Abstract

Dynamic all-optical flip-fop operation is observed for a single distributed feedback laser diode using the spatial hole burning effect. Bistabilities with extinction ratios of up to 35 dB are obtained. For the flip-flop operation, we observe repetition rates up to 1.25 GHz using pulses of 0.5 pJ.
